Damages that are awarded in lawsuits over car accidents There are many kinds of damages that may be awarded in a case of car accident. They include both economic and non-economic damage. Economic damages are monetary compensation for the loss of a person's income. The most common economic damages are medical expenses as well as physical therapy and repair bills. In cases of gross negligence, a judge might give punitive damages in addition to compensatory damages. This kind of damages are granted to punish the responsible party and discourage them from becoming reckless in the future. In certain states, punitive damages can be restricted. New York City Statute of Limitations for the filing of a case The time limit to file an injury lawsuit in New York City is different depending on the type of. A personal injury lawsuit has three years of limitation for filing a lawsuit, while a case involving the death of a victim has two years. The statute of limitations doesn't always apply when there is an accident. You must notify New York City within 90 days of an accident to bring a lawsuit. This is known as the Notice of Claim deadline. The deadline may be extended if you or the other party were in an unsound state of mind at the time of the incident. There are exceptions to the time limit. Lawyers should be consulted promptly following an accident. The time limit for personal injury claims is three years but it can be shorter or longer based on the circumstances and parties involved. If you or someone you love was killed in a car accident the statute of limitations is two years. The statute of limitations isn't as severe for a wrongful death lawsuit. In this regard, it is recommended to get in touch with a New York personal injury attorney right after the accident. This will ensure that your lawsuit is filed in time and safeguard your rights. If the defendant is a government organization, the statute of limitations will be more severe. A motion to dismiss your case might be required before the statute expires. It is therefore essential to speak with a lawyer as soon as you can so that they can collect evidence before it is lost. The statute of limitations for personal injury claims in New York City generally starts in the day the plaintiff realizes that they have been injured. In some cases, the statute could be extended if the injury is not obvious.
